Price Comparison

The Clek Foonf Convertible Car Seat is priced at $559.99, while the Graco Extend2Fit Convertible Baby Car Seat is significantly more affordable at $239.99, making it about 57% cheaper. This substantial price difference may influence parents looking for a budget-friendly option without compromising safety. While the Clek Foonf is known for its premium features and build quality, the Graco Extend2Fit offers essential safety and comfort at a lower price point, making it an attractive choice for cost-conscious families.

Safety Features

In terms of safety, the Clek Foonf boasts advanced features that promote child safety during both rear-facing and forward-facing modes. It incorporates a Steel Anti-Rebound bar and a REACT Crumple Zone that absorbs collision energy, enhancing child protection. On the other hand, the Graco Extend2Fit is Graco ProtectPlus Engineered, meeting rigorous testing standards for side and frontal impacts. Both car seats prioritize safety, but the Clek Foonf’s innovative technologies position it as a leader in crash protection, appealing to parents who prioritize high-end safety features.

Ease of Installation

Both the Clek Foonf and Graco Extend2Fit offer user-friendly installation systems, although they differ in approach. The Clek Foonf features a Rigid-LATCH system that simplifies installation and ensures a secure fit in seconds. Conversely, the Graco Extend2Fit employs the InRight LATCH system for an easy one-second attachment, providing an audible click for confirmation. Ease of installation is crucial for busy parents, and while both options excel, the choice may come down to personal preference based on the specific installation environment.

Comfort and Adjustability

When it comes to comfort, the Clek Foonf is designed with an adjustable headrest and a reclining feature, ensuring a comfortable ride for children. Its solid metal substructure and energy-absorbing foam layers further enhance comfort during travel. The Graco Extend2Fit also emphasizes comfort, featuring a 6-position recline and a no-rethread harness system that adjusts the headrest and harness together. However, the Extend2Fit’s unique 4-position adjustable extension panel provides up to 5 inches of additional legroom for rear-facing use, which may be a significant benefit for taller children.

Longevity and Growth

Both car seats are designed to grow with your child, but they cater to slightly different age ranges. The Clek Foonf supports extended rear-facing use up to 50 pounds, allowing children to remain rear-facing until their fourth birthday. The Graco Extend2Fit also supports rear-facing use up to 50 pounds but transitions to forward-facing use from 26.5 to 65 pounds, making it versatile for a broader age range. This focus on longevity makes the Graco Extend2Fit particularly appealing for parents looking for a car seat that adapts as their child grows.

Design and Aesthetics

The Clek Foonf showcases a modern and stylish design, available in various colors and patterns, appealing to parents who value aesthetics as much as functionality. Its flame-retardant-free materials and sleek look contribute to its upscale appeal. Meanwhile, the Graco Extend2Fit, particularly in the Gotham color scheme, provides a more classic look with practical features. While personal taste will dictate preferences in design, both car seats offer attractive options that can complement any vehicle interior.
